Demand for Nigerian crude drops in Asia

EXCEPT it finds buyers as soon as possible, the Federal Government’s capacity to finance the 2015 National Budget has been further reduced, as demand for Nigeria’s crude drops in the Asia market. The development increases concern of higher budget deficits in the current financial year.

Solar-powered internet drone completes first test flight

A PORTUGUESE startup that aims to use solar-powered drones to provide wireless internet access to offline areas of the world claims to have successfully completed its maiden test flight. The company Quarkson plans to use the SkyOrbiter drones that will stay airborne for weeks, months or even years at a time and will fly at altitudes of up to 22,000 metres.

Low crude oil prices leave thousands of US wells uncompleted

In February EOG Resources Inc. said it would delay a significant number of well completions and plans to close out 2015 with 285 uncompleted wells, up from 200 at the end of 2014. Continental Resources Inc. Apache Corp. and Anadarko Petroleum Corp. have also said that they plan to delay well completions until crude oil prices pick up again.
